The Social Hub has neither the comforts of a dorm nor a hotel. Rooms are constantly filthy (never vacuumed, never dusted, never have anything but the sink in the bathroom cleaned). Kitchens are worse (broken glass on the floor, cigarette butts everywhere, smoke detectors that seemingly don't work). Social events are rare and sometimes cancelled without notice and almost all cost extra. Staff are dismissive - whining about how they dont want to "be your guys' mom" as an excuse to force residents to try and curtail behaviour a la the kitchen smoking and broken glass with each other; As if you, the resident paying upwards of a thousand euros a month, should have to be the mom of the random strangers on your floor instead. Not to mention, frequent water issues and the internet cutting out for the entirety of exam week. Overall, the only possible reason you could justify staying here is if you're international student and need a BSN badly. If that's you and you're still considering the Social Hub, I'd advise only booking the shortest stay possible and finding your own place ASAP. Everyone else: avoid at all costs.

The open desk is the way to go if you’re looking for a flexible workspace in an open environment where you can socialize with other members. Or, choose a dedicated desk if you want a designated space that also allows you to keep in touch with the community.
A private office works wonders if you or your team need a quiet, secluded space to conduct your work and interact with people in your organization.
It’s important to understand the different types of coworking arrangements available to you, depending on the type of work that you do and its duration, and whether you’re a solo worker or part of a team.
Most, if not all, amenities are available to you as a member, regardless of the type of membership. Some shared spaces, like the meeting rooms, need to be booked in advance and private offices are only available for those with a subscription. However, all the other areas, like the lounge, kitchen and breakout spaces, are usable by every member.
